iLoveDocsTools
All ToolsValidate XML with XSD

Validate XML with XSD

Validate XML well-formedness and check structure against an XSD schema. Browser-based.

GuestGUEST

10 uses remaining today

XML Document

XSD Schema (optional)

Your files never leave your device. All processing happens locally in your browser — nothing is uploaded to our servers.Files are never stored on our servers · No tracking of your file contentsPrivacy Policy

What is Validate XML with XSD?

Validate XML is a free online tool that checks if your XML is well-formed and performs basic structural validation against an optional XSD schema. It uses the browser's built-in DOMParser for well-formedness checks and a custom element/attribute checker for XSD validation.

How It Works

XML well-formedness is checked using the browser's DOMParser (application/xml). If the XML contains a <parsererror> element in the result, the XML is invalid and the error message is extracted. For XSD validation, the tool parses the XSD to extract expected element names and checks them against the XML structure.

How to Use

  1. 1

    Paste your XML

    Paste the XML content you want to validate into the input area.

  2. 2

    Validate

    Click "Validate". The tool checks the document for well-formedness: matching tags, proper nesting, and valid attribute syntax.

  3. 3

    Review errors

    Any errors are listed with line numbers and descriptions. Fix each one and re-validate.

  4. 4

    Use for schema validation (optional)

    Upload an XSD schema file to validate your XML against a specific structure definition.

Who Uses This Tool

🔐

SOAP Web Service Testing

Validate SOAP envelope XML before sending it to a web service to catch malformed requests early.

📋

Schema Compliance Checks

Verify that XML data files conform to a supplied XSD schema before processing them in an application.

🗂️

Config File Validation

Check Maven, Spring, or Android manifest XML files for well-formedness errors after manual edits.

🧪

CI/CD Pipeline Integration

Use as a quick manual check during development before automated schema validation runs in the pipeline.

📡

API Data Validation

Verify XML responses from third-party APIs to ensure they match the expected structure before parsing.

📦

Data Migration Quality

Validate exported XML datasets before importing them into a new system to prevent silent data corruption.

Why Choose This Tool

Well-Formedness Detection

Uses the browser's native DOMParser to check XML syntax according to the W3C specification with no dependencies.

Basic XSD Validation

Optionally paste an XSD schema to check that all element names in your XML are declared in the schema.

Clear Error Messages

Parser error text is extracted and displayed directly so you know exactly which tag or character is invalid.

Element Count Summary

Displays the total element count on success, giving a quick sanity check that the document is complete.

Optional Schema Input

Validate XML alone or with a schema — both modes are available so the tool fits any workflow.

Client-Side Privacy

No XML or XSD data is ever uploaded, making it safe to validate confidential enterprise documents.

Key Benefits

  • Validates XML well-formedness using the browser DOMParser
  • Basic XSD schema validation (element names and nesting)
  • Clear error messages with details
  • Optional XSD — validate XML alone or with a schema
  • 100% client-side — no files uploaded to any server

Frequently Asked Questions

Also Known As

xml validator online freevalidate xml against xsd onlinexml well-formedness checkercheck xml syntax onlineonline xml schema validatorxsd validation online toolxml validator browser basedvalidate xml no upload

Trusted Worldwide

Free Online Document Tools for Everyone

iLoveDocsTools is used by students, professionals, and businesses across the United States, Canada, United Kingdom, Australia, India, and more than 100 other countries. All tools are browser-based and process files privately — your files never leave your device. Free to use, with Pro plans for unlimited access.

No Upload Required

All processing happens directly in your browser. Your documents are never sent to any server — complete privacy guaranteed for users in the USA, Canada, UK, and worldwide.

Free to Use — Pro Plans Available

Every tool on iLoveDocsTools is free to use. Need more? Upgrade to Pro for unlimited usage, priority access, and no daily limits. Trusted by students, freelancers, and teams across North America and Europe.

Works on Any Device

Whether you are on a Mac, Windows PC, iPhone, or Android in New York, Toronto, London, or Sydney — our tools work instantly in any modern browser.

Looking for free PDF tools in the USA? Free document converters in Canada? Online PDF editors in the UK or Australia? iLoveDocsTools offers 70+ free tools — merge PDF, split PDF, compress PDF, convert Word to PDF, Excel to PDF, JPG to PDF, and many more — all free, all instant, all private. No watermarks. No file size limits. Just free tools that work.